Actually, the problem is not upwind from a wind turbine but downwind. Wind turbines do not suck in object like aircraft propellers do, quite the opposite, they slow down the wind, both in front of the rotor plane and behind the rotor plane, see the explanation here:
Wind flow around a turbine
Downwind the problem is that wind turbines create turbulence in their downstream wake, see the graphics here:
Wind turbine wake effect
Wind turbine wakes can be felt quite far away downstream, see this image:
Horn Rev I offshore wind farm, Denmark
The reason why you see the cloud formation in the image is that the air temperature and the humidity are a value where the pressure drop behind the rotor plane cools the air off, so that condensation starts.
